Otis is a T reg 1979 Austin Mini 1000

He has just over 50k miles on him.

He has MOT till late august I think, and a few months tax.

He is in the lovely mustard (sandglow) colour, definately the period colour of the late 70's.

Complete with the deckchair pattern interior and centre dash.

He is running on 10" GB alloys

Floors were all replaced before I got him, and apart from that the rest of him is all very solid and very original, he has a bit of bubbling at the bottom of the doors, but has been the same since I got him well over a year ago.

Even the MOT tester said he is very good for a mini, of 34 years of age!

If I am honest I do not really wish to sell him, but as I am using my 98 Cooper MPI daily, he just sits in the garage doing nothing, and I think someone else should enjoy him!
